Chest-to-chest and hip-to-hip, two dancers tangoing is one of the most exciting spectacles to watch. Fleet-footed hoofers convey sensuality, anger, or euphoria. In Tango Undressed — the brainchild of Ray Sullivan, Miami Contemporary Dance Company’s founding artistic director and resident choreographer — the traditional dance is given a contemporary makeover that pushes the limits of the Argentine style. This Friday the Colony Theatre will host this critically acclaimed new-age production. Expect sequins and elaborate costumes, but most of all, expect to be enthralled by the fluid movements of the dance style synonymous with passion.

Fri., May 15, 8 p.m., 2009
